Role: iOS developer
Location: Melbourne
Contract Duration- 6 months duration
Job Description:
Position Overview: We are seeking a talented iOS Developer to join a high-performing team working closely with the Tech Lead for Mobile and the Client Tech Lead. The primary responsibility will be contributing to the development of a high-volume consumer application for one of the four major banks. This is an exciting opportunity to work on cutting-edge mobile banking solutions.
Key Responsibilities:
- iOS Developer (5-8 Years of iOS Development Experience)
- Collaborate with cross-functional teams to design, develop, and maintain iOS applications.
- Work with Swift, Xcode, and C++ to create high-quality mobile applications.
- Contribute to all stages of the iOS app development lifecycle, including planning, coding, testing, and deployment.
- Write and maintain unit tests to ensure desired code coverage and application functionality.
- Develop reusable components and implement CI/CD pipelines for seamless integration and deployment.
- Work within an agile development environment, following best practices and collaborating with both technical and non-technical teams.
- Support and troubleshoot existing applications, ensuring reliability and performance.
Must-Have Skills:
- 5-8 years of relevant iOS mobile development experience.
- Strong proficiency in Swift, Xcode, and C++.
- In-depth knowledge of iOS lifecycle and the various components of iOS app development.
- Solid experience with version control tools such as Git, including branching strategies.
- Ability to work independently and effectively in a collaborative, fast-paced environment.
- Strong understanding of the agile development process and ability to adapt to changing requirements.
- Prior experience with banking applications or the financial services sector.
Nice-to-Have Skills:
- Familiarity with Android development (not required, but advantageous).
- Experience with automation testing in iOS, including the creation of test scripts.
- Strong knowledge of CI/CD build plans for automated deployment.
- Prior experience in creating reusable components and libraries.
- Background knowledge in the banking sector is a plus.
General Information:
- Candidate must be adaptable and comfortable working in a hybrid environment, with 50% in-office presence in Melbourne.
- The role is set to start in the first week of March, with onboarding taking approximately four weeks.
- There is potential for contract extension based on performance and business needs.
Contract Details:
- Duration: 6 months (with potential for extension)
- Number of Positions: 1
Location: Melbourne (Hybrid - 50% in-office presence mandatory)
About the Client:
- This is an exciting opportunity to work with one of the four major banks, contributing to the development of a high-volume consumer application that plays a critical role in the bank's digital strategy.
- If you're passionate about mobile development and looking to make an impact with a top-tier banking institution, we'd love to hear from you!
Desirable Skills:
- Knowledge of the Insurance Domain.
Contact:
Yusuf Naeem
Key Skills
Ranked by relevance
Related Jobs
3 roles aligned with this opportunity
iOS Developer (ARC, OB)
2024-10-26
iOS Developer (ARC, OB)
2024-10-26
iOS Developer
2024-10-25
- Posted
- Feb 03, 2025
- Type
- Contract
- Level
- Entry
- Location
- Melbourne
- Company
- Turing Consulting
Industries
Categories
Related Jobs
3 roles aligned with this opportunity
iOS Developer (ARC, OB)
2024-10-26
iOS Developer (ARC, OB)
2024-10-26
iOS Developer
2024-10-25